Ace of Spades is one. I usually play with the OpenSpades client[1], but there is also Betterspades[2], and probably many other clients I don't know of yet. There are usually about 10-50 players online on the public servers listed on BuildAndShoot[3], variable depending on the time of day and mostly from Latin America it seems.
One can host the game with piqueserver[4]. I'm not sure if one can still host with the original Ace of Spades server, but the game was 'shut down' in 2019 so maybe not.

JK-XR: Outcast - The Standalone VR port of Jedi Knight II: Jedi Outcast
JK XR is a VR port of the Jedi Knight games using OpenXR (the open standard for virtual and augmented reality devices) and is based on the excellent OpenJK port, originally forked from: https://github.com/JACoders/OpenJK
